LRA Commander Dominic Ongwen’s Pre-Trial To Be Telecast

The Pre-trial session of former Lord’s Resistance Army (LRA) commander Dominic Ongwen will tomorrow be telecast in areas affected by the insurgency.
Addressing the media in Kampala, International Criminal Court (ICC’s) outreach officer for Uganda and Kenya Maria Mabity Kamara says this will be done in Kampala, Gulu and in Soroti specifically in villages of Odek, Abia, Pajule and Balayo.
This is after the court administration failed to have the trail held here due to the ongoing electoral activities and costs involved.
The 60-day trial will see court pronouncing itself on whether or not to confirm charges against Ongwen, or to order a fresh investigation by the prosecution in relation to the 20 years of insurgency in Northern Uganda.
